Barclays PLC bought a new position in Ingram Micro Holding Corp. (NYSE:INGM - Free Report) in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und bought 56,348 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$1,092,000.
Several other hedge funds and other institutional investors have also recently modified their holdings of the company. CenterBook Partners LP purchased a new stake in Ingram Micro during the fourth quarter valued at $1,224,000. Invesco Ltd. purchased a new stake in Ingram Micro during the fourth quarter valued at approximately $667,000. Russell Investments Group Ltd. purchased a new position in shares of Ingram Micro during the 4th quarter worth $120,000. Wells Fargo & Company MN bought a new stake in shares of Ingram Micro during the 4th quarter valued at $45,000. Finally, Geode Capital Management LLC purchased a new position in Ingram Micro during the fourth quarter valued at $1,693,000.

Ingram Micro (NYSE:INGM -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, March 4th. The company reported $0.92 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.91 by $0.01. The business had revenue of $13.34 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$13.21 billion. Sell-side analysts forecast that Ingram Micro Holding Corp. will post 2.71 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Ingram Micro Announces Dividend
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, March 25th.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, March 11th were issued a $0.074 dividend. This represents a $0.30 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.56%. The ex-dividend date was Tuesday, March 11th.
Ingram Micro announced that its Board of Directors has approved a share repurchase program on Tuesday, March 4th that permits the company to buyback $75.00 million in outstanding shares. This buyback authorization permits the company to reacquire up to 1.5% of its shares through open market purchases.
